Oren - what do you do to secure your bike during your trip? I am planning a Malaysia/Thailand bike trip over the Xmas/New Year time and the biggest concern for me is the safety of my bike. When I went to KL/Penang in the past, that was my biggest problem. Any suggestions?

 

Also, is there a way for me to take my bike from Mersing to Tioman? Or is there a place in Mersing where I can leave my bike and be sure that I will find it after I return?

 

Hi Manik,

This was a real concern for me before the trip. I can now say that except Malaysia, all other countries are very safe. So that gives you a bit of answer :p Here are some tips that I used and perfected with this trip:

- Always ask for your motorbike parking when booking a hotel: read reviews, or call the hotel is best. If you can;t get that info, look at customers photos: sometimes you can see a security guard, a parking in front of the hotel.

 

- If there is no parking, with security, then ask the hotel if you can put your bike inside the lobby for the night. Around 11pm you get it in, and wake up early at the time they want (usually 7am is ok) and take it out.

 

- Take a bike cover with you: not only will it protect your bike from rain and dust but also avoid to attract too much attention. Take something old, black or grey. Not a brand new cover super nice. Something cheapo but that covers the bike. I currently use a thick Pancho gotten in Vietnam.

 

- Put a disc lock : doesn't have to be an expensive lock. I am using a normal big ass lock that won't be easy to cut open or break with a hammer. I also use a wire I DIY that we use to lock our gear to the bike if we park it and have to go somewhere. For example, you eat across the street or stop to go to the toilet and you're alone etc.. The wire goes through the helmet, jacket and front wheel. I have never used it outside Malaysia for that purpose. I use it to lock the bike to a tree or pole in front of the hotel if there is no staff there at night.

 

[EDIT]: Just realized after reading that you're not riding a Pulsar anymore. I don;t know how popular your current bike is in MY. But the principles above still apply!

 

Now the good news:

 

- Pulsar is inexistent in Thailand. So people won't bother with the bike unless you have fancy rims and stuff on it.

- Pulsar is not a bike people dream of like Ducatis, or BMWs or even big Yamahas.

- Things are always far better than we imagine in our worse nightmares. Being Singaporean (or leaving here for a while !), we have kiasuness and fear of getting chopped in us. Which makes us think the world is out to rob us. The truth is, every country we went through, people were just happy to know about the bike, and very happy to help us with its security anyway they can. People understand it's your travel mode and you don;t want anything to happen to it, so just ask, and they will arrange a safe parking for it.

- Malaysia is not the land of robbers Singaporeans like to sometimes describe. Just common sense in handling your belongings and bike and you'll be fine. Don;t leave anything on the bike unlocked, and as much as possible stay close to it if parked in the street. That's it really, and you'll be fine.

 

We went to KL, Penang, and stopped many times on rest areas having to leave the bike to go at. We just make sure everything is locked + bike is in our sight, if not, we eat quickly or check on the bike from time to time. Very easy to ark the bike in your sight. And when at the hotel, just ask for help in parking it safely. If you don;t trust the security to look after it, ask to bring the bike inside. Or take time to find the right hotel. There is a thread on SBF with suggestions for hotels where bikes are safe.

 

Or you can let me know where you are going during your trip and if we hit the same spots, I'll share with you the accommodation we used.

Last advice: pack light. If you are riding alone, make sure you don't take more than a tank bag and 2 saddle bags or 1 back box. Ideally you want 2 bags in total. If with a pillion, careful not to pack too much. Riding light makes a HUGE difference in terms of fatigue, bike control and handling. Going for a longer trip will make you want to be ready for everything hence pack a lot. But less is more, always !

 

Hope this helps, ask more if something is unclear !

 

I always wanted to ride to mersing and leave the bike there to go diving in Tioman or other nearby islands. I have explored the possibility of leaving the bike with a local, paying something for them to guard it safely inside their home or something. But I never went with it, not convinced I trust a stranger enough.. If it's someone recommended to me, ok, but a stranger can do whatever with your bike while you're away for 2-3 days and then tell you it's not his ault someone broke into their house or parking. I read stories of riders who actually pin the bike down like a tent with pegs hammered in the ground and a chain running through them. Cant imagine myself doing that.. but I think if we go as a group, we can probably get a hotel or restaurant in Mersing to keep our bikes for a few days for a fee. I guess someone has to try it first..:)
